What this means for live dealer players in the UK

For live dealer enthusiasts, these new casinos mean enhanced options for engaging gameplay, but they also require careful consideration. Players should evaluate the credibility of these new platforms before leaving behind trusted names like Sky Vegas or Ladbrokes. Ensure to verify their licensing through the UKGC public register and assess the payout methods available, as options like Faster Payments can affect how quickly you receive your winnings.
